MMK, SMS mull hydrogen cooperation to eliminate CO2
Russian steelmaker MMK and SMS Group have signed a memorandum of understanding to cooperate in the development and use of decarbonisation technologies aimed at reducing and potentially eliminating CO2 emissions.
